FEATURED SESSION: Built to Perform, Styled to Inspire: How Design and Storytelling Shape the Culture of Running

Dec 02 2025

4:45 PM - 5:30 PM CST

Stars at Night Ballroom 1 & 2

OPEN TO ALL BADGEHOLDERS! 

Behind every shoe, piece of apparel, or gear that runners love is a design journey that blends creativity, performance, and storytelling. In this session, a panel of industry leaders will share their paths, highlight memorable projects, and explore how innovation continues to shape the future of running.

Design is never just about product. It is about roots, heritage, and cultural influences that shape how people move and express themselves today. This conversation will show how storytelling transforms shopping from a transaction into a meaningful connection. When retailers carry the design process story from its historical origins through its cultural context, customers leave with more than gear. They leave with a story to share with friends, communities, and platforms like TikTok, creating a cycle of loyalty, pride, and cultural relevance that strengthens both the retailer and the community.
